Conditionalize extra tests

epel9
Petr Písař 4 years ago
parent b4ad6279b9
commit 21f174a509

@ -1,3 +1,6 @@
# Perform release tests
%bcond_without perl_Spiffy_enables_extra_test
Name: perl-Spiffy
Version: 0.46
Release: 18%{?dist}
@ -24,8 +27,10 @@ BuildRequires: perl(base)
BuildRequires: perl(Cwd)
BuildRequires: perl(lib)
BuildRequires: perl(Test::More)
%if %{with perl_Spiffy_enables_extra_test}
# Release Tests:
BuildRequires: perl(Test::Pod) >= 1.41
%endif
Requires: perl(:MODULE_COMPAT_%(eval "`perl -V:version`"; echo $version))
Requires: perl(Data::Dumper)
Requires: perl(Filter::Util::Call)
@ -57,7 +62,8 @@ find $RPM_BUILD_ROOT -type f -name .packlist -exec rm -f {} \;
%{_fixperms} $RPM_BUILD_ROOT/*
%check
make test RELEASE_TESTING=1
unset RELEASE_TESTING
make test %{?with_perl_Spiffy_enables_extra_test:RELEASE_TESTING=1}
# Support use of %%license on old distributions
%{!?_licensedir:%global license %%doc}

Loading…
Cancel
Save